Summary: |
"From the fabric of memory and personal recollection, there has come a series of tales of a Hawaii
which is no more, of a world which disappeared in the turbulent decades which followed
the tragic overthrow of the Hawaiian Monarchy...." "...Portrays with depth and feeling the personalities who made their way through
these [post-monarchy] decades, seeking their adjustment in the new life which had been
thrust uipon them. Gothic in dimension, they come forward with firmness and clarity.
All remain to haunt the reader with poignancy and nostalgia.
Rising to a crescendo, the night rides of Hawaii's own Kaiulani carry the reader forward,
even as the hooves of the Arabian mare upon which she rides pound the silent roads
and pathways of Honolulu. This volume of stories, from the pen of Holt,
